Types of Hose Connectors
There are several types of hose connectors available on the market, each designed for specific purposes. Some common types include quick-connect hose connectors, threaded hose connectors, and push-fit hose connectors. Quick-connect hose connectors are popular for their ease of use, allowing users to quickly attach and detach hoses without the need for tools. Threaded hose connectors, on the other hand, require twisting onto the hose for a secure connection. Push-fit hose connectors are designed for easy installation, simply push the hose into the connector for a tight seal.

How to Choose the Right Hose Connector
When choosing a hose connector, it’s essential to consider factors such as the type of hose you’ll be using, the water pressure in your system, and the specific needs of your irrigation setup. For example, if you have a high-pressure system, you’ll need a hose connector that can withstand the pressure without leaking. Similarly, if you’re using a specific type of hose, such as a soaker hose, you’ll need a connector that is compatible with that particular hose.
Installation and Maintenance
Installing a hose connector is a simple process that can be done by following the manufacturer’s instructions. Typically, you’ll need to cut the hose to the desired length, insert the connector into the hose, and secure it in place using a clamp or other fastening device. Regular maintenance of hose connectors is essential to ensure they continue to function correctly. This includes checking for leaks, cleaning the connectors regularly, and replacing any damaged parts as needed.
